Four weeks left for BPS application
Farmers need to be aware that the deadline for the Basic Payment Scheme (BPS) online application is 15 May 2019. It is an extremely important part of the majority of farmer’s income and if at all possible should not be left to the last minute. Farmers can make the application themselves or through an agent. This is also the deadline for the Areas of Natural Constraint (ANC) scheme, Young Farmers Scheme, transfer of entitlements and National Reserve applications. The Department is assisting farmers via one-to-one clinics country-wide. Details are available on farmersjournal.ie.
